i just put in new rotors in the front with brand new oem pads and when i took it for a ride you can hear the driver side rotor make a rubbing type noise lik its sliding against the pad....i took the wheel off and everything was the same exact way as the passenger side and that side is fine...i have done brakes many times on other cars and had not 1 problem...any advise?...also had a clutch sqeak when you push the clutch in it will sqeak...i greased it and went away then came back 2 days after i just greased it again and see wut happens...any advice on that 2?....thankx...
What kind of sound is it? Metal on metal? Pad on metal?
You may have bent the shield around the rotor and its rubbing on the rotor.
Also, Did you perform the bed in process? That may take car of some of the noise if its actually the pad on the rotor making noise.

Do a search on here, or look on the box that the pads came in for the exact procedure.
to bed in yes, do like 5 runs from 40mph, hard brake to about 5mph-not coming to a complete stop. Then you can do 1 or 2 from 60 to 5mph(complete stop optional here) that should bed them nicely
